    April 10, 2011 - Blackish color. A fresh, deep wine with lovely earth and forest floor flavors. Really robust and ripe with a slight raisiny note. As compared with the classically-styled '04 that I had recently, this is richer but not as precise and clearly showing the effects of a hot vintage. That being said, it's still a wonderful wine with that "lift" of texture that is this wine's signature. Finishes quite complex and concentrated with notes of dried black cherries and a hint of wintergreen. I would drink this now as the raisin flavors weren't there 2 years ago when I last tasted it.
